No more honeymoon for Vicki and Hayden?

The three-meter long train blush wedding gown of Vicki, designed by Michael Cinco, is made of French lace and tulle with full silk embroidery on top in baroque patterns with sequins, pearls and transparent and Rose Opal Swarovski crystals. And it took 1,000 hours to finish with 50 skilled artisans.

If the local showbiz firmament looked a bit dimmer over the weekend, it’s because most of the big stars chose to shine in Paris during the breath-taking Christian wedding of Dr. Vicki Belo and Dr. Hayden Kho on Saturday, Sept. 2, ushered in by a leisurely cruise along the River Seine the day before.

The grand reception was held at the Palais Garnier (Paris Opera House) rented for one day by the couple weeks earlier (to the tune of…guess how much).

Most of the 250 invited guests came from showbiz, with those “left behind” wondering why they failed to make it to the elite guest list even if they were ready, willing and able to shoulder the airfare and hotel accommodation, asking in silence if the lucky stars enjoyed an all-expense-paid Parisian holiday.

All roads led to the French capital, trodden by actors and actresses (among other well-heeled guests) who didn’t mind losing sleep as they taped “advance” episodes of their shows or putting work on hold. Better to wilt on the set than to miss the roll call at the Wedding Of The Year in comparison to which paled the weddings of some Hollywood superstars.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ie opted to exchange vows at a beautiful chapel far, far from the public’s prying eyes, didn’t they?

Let’s call the (showbiz) roll once more:

Ogie Alcasid and wife Regine Velasquez came with their son Nate (Ring Bearer) a week earlier since Ogie had to celebrate his 50th birthday in the City of Light (Vicki and Hayden prefer to call it “City of Love”), along with Ogie’s ex-wife Michelle van Eimeren and their daughters Leila and Sarah; Alden Richards was a last-minute arrival, departing Manila Saturday morning after wrapping up some projects and making to Paris in time for the Seine Cruise where he met up with the likes of Piolo Pascual, Ormoc City Mayor Richard Gomez and wife Ormoc Rep. Lucy Torres (with daughter Juliana); Conrad Onglao and Zsa Zsa Padilla (with daughter Zia and boyfriend Robin Nievera); Isabelle Daza and husband Adrien Semblat; Lovi Poe and French boyfriend Chris Johnson; Jinkee Pacquiao (minus husband Sen. Manny Pacquiao); Korina Sanchez (minus husband Mar Roxas); and Dingdong Dantes and wife Marian Rivera with daughter Zia (Flower Girl, with Vicki and Hayden’s daughter Scarlet who did the drums during the reception hosted by Ogie and where Regine dedicated a song to the newlyweds).

 

 

Mom Marian made sure that she lugged along Baby Zia’s needs (feeding bottles and all), at one point breastfed Zia in a quiet corner, much to the delight of those around.

Perhaps the biggest “disappointment” was the no-show (oops! there goes that word again!) of a French VIP bruited about to be the event’s guest of honor, and a popular Hollywood actor (Bradley Cooper, was that you?). Had those two huge celebs came, could they have over-shadowed all the stars out together from native Philippines?
